Is it possible to set a dialout device priority between the UCM/GSM4 and telephone line?
I would like to use the UCM/GSM4 for all communications but if the GSM network is not available for some reason use the telephone line for external communications.
Is this possible?
Thanks,
David


- ident - 09-17-2014

No, the dial out priority is the opposite way, ie it wil atempt to dial out by the telephone line and if that is not available, use the GSM. That is normally preferred because it saves money
